                Freezy Setup My experience is with Virtual DMD and Pin2dmd
                Some troubleshooting help at the bottom of the post

                Do not use the 64 bit Version — dmdext-v1.x.x-x64
                Freezy files  dmdext-v1.x.x-x86.zip  — https://github.com/freezy/dmd-extensions#features
                Download the zip file
                An out of this zip file I used – DmdDevice.dll and dmdext.exe – But you may also need the other files if you don’t have them (If your New To Freezy)
                If UpDating make a copy of this file —  DmdDevice.ini
                The Files go in the VPinMame folder  ( Visual Pinball\VPinMame )
                NOTE: When you make changes in The DMDdevice.INI File you must restart VP In order for the changes to take Effect

                NOTE:  If  you are using the Pinbally front end you will also need the DmdDevice64.dll file from the 64 bit version of Freezy

                New options: Right click Menu and Always display Grip on hover.. (Really convenient for someone that has a 2 screen set up)

                In your VPinMame folder run setup.exe change defaults and/or for games you have already run Use F1 during game to change the default for that game
                Turn off Show DMD and Turn on external DMD
                VPM Default
                Put this in your (DmdDevice.ini) file (If it’s not already there) and set it to true or false depending on whether you want to use Alphanumeric features [alphanumeric]
                enabled = false

                              [global]
                              ; how to downscale SEGA 192×64 pixel games to smaller displays: fit, fill or stretch
                              resize = fit
                              ; flips the image horizontally
                              fliphorizontally = false
                              ; flips the image vertically
                              flipvertically = false
                              ; enable or disable frame-by-frame colorization (inactive in VPX bundle)
                              colorize = true

                              ; a DMD that renders with nice dots on a computer monitor
                              [virtualdmd]
                              enabled = true
                              ; virtual dmd stays on top of all other windows
                              stayontop = false
                              ; hide the resize grip
                              hidegrip = false
                              ; ignore the aspect ratio of the rendered dots when resizing
                              ignorear = false
                              ; use VPM’s registry values when positioning the virtual dmd
                              useregistry = false
                              ; x-axis of the window position
                              left = 0
                              ; y-axis of the window position
                              top = 0
                              ; width of the dmd in monitor pixels
                              width = 1024
                              ; height of the dmd in monitor pixels
                              height = 256
                              ; scale the dot size (set to 0.8 for same size as pre-1.6.0)
                              dotsize = 1.0

                              [pindmd1]
                              ; if false, doesn’t bother looking for a pinDMD1
                              enabled = false

                              [pindmd2]
                              ; if false, doesn’t bother looking for a pinDMD2
                              enabled = false

                              [pindmd3]
                              ; if false, doesn’t bother looking for a pinDMD3
                              enabled = false
                              ; COM port, e.g. COM3
                              port =

                              [pin2dmd]
                              ; if false, doesn’t bother looking for a PIN2DMD
                              enabled = false
                              ; how long to wait in milliseconds after sending a palette
                              delay = 25

                              [browserstream]
                              ; if enabled, stream to your browser in your LAN
                              enabled = false
                              port = 9090

                              [vpdbstream]
                              ; if enabled, stream DMD to https://test.vpdb.io/live
                              enabled = false
                              endpoint = https://api-test.vpdb.io/

                              ; if enabled, writes frames to an .avi file
                              enabled = false
                              ; path to folder or .avi file. if folder, gamename.avi is used.
                              path =

                              [pinup]
                              ; if enabled, send frames to PinUP.
                              enabled = false

                                          Go here and at the top of the page click where it says frenzy/DMD extensions and in there it will give you an example

                                          https://github.com/freezy/dmd-extensions/pull/152

                                          ;Bay Watch
                                          [baywatch]
                                          virtualdmd left = 2500
                                          virtualdmd top = 800
                                          virtualdmd width = 1024
                                          virtualdmd height = 256
